News 6.2 magnitude earthquake strikes near Indonesia’s Aceh Province By maritimemag January 8, 2020 ShareTweet 0 A 6.2 magnitude earthquake struck the southwest of Indonesia’s Aceh Province on the island of Sumatra on Tuesday, U.S. Geological Survey (USGS) said. The epicentre was recorded at a depth of 20.3 km, USGS said. But the Indonesian meteorology and geophysics agency said on Twitter the quake had a magnitude of 6.4, at a depth of 13 km. No tsunami warning has been issued so far, and there is no immediate report on possible damages and casualties. © 2020, maritimemag. All rights reserved.
